The Smoky Mountains are a top destination for family vacations! That's because the area is overflowing with incredible, kid-friendly things to do. To help guarantee you have the best vacation with your children, we've come up with 5 of the best things to do in the Smoky Mountains for kids.
Ripley's Aquarium is not only one of the top aquariums in the country, it's on the top of our list for things to do in the Smoky Mountains for kids! That's because the Gatlinburg aquarium provides both an educational and fun visit for children. Kids love traveling through the underwater tunnel and seeing their favorite sea animals swimming all around them. The aquarium also has a Discovery Center, where the kids can not only learn about the different animals, but will have the chance to touch a jellyfish and a horseshoe crab! There are also a number of unique experiences that allow the kids to interact with the animals, like Turtle Time, during which they can feed Sally the Sea Turtle, and the Penguin Encounter, during which they can waddle with penguins!
What better place to bring your kids for a day filled with family fun than the world-class theme park, Dollywood? Though you might know Dollywood for its thrilling rides, the park has plenty of kid-friendly activities as well! They can spend the day flying around in elephants, playing on a playground, riding a carousel and so much more. Not to mention, the park has family-friendly shows, delicious eateries and places to shop where the kids can pick out a souvenir to take back home!
Country Tonite is the best show in Pigeon Forge for families. Part of the reason is because it's the only show in the area that has youth performers! Don't let the name fool you - you don't have to be a fan of country music to love the show. The performance features singing, dancing, comedy, powerful gospel and American patriotism for a feel-good show both children and parents will love. And the best part is that kids get in for free! Children 12 and under are free with the admission of a paying adult.
WonderWorks is an indoor amusement park filled with more than 100 hands-on exhibits that are designed to challenge the mind and spark the imagination. Kids love exploring the different WonderZones, where they can learn about natural disasters, space and more through interactive experiences. One you finish exploring the WonderZones, head to the Indoor Ropes Challenge for a 4-story, glow-in-the-dark adventure that will challenge them one step at a time, or play a game of laser tag!
5. The Island in Pigeon Forge
The Island in Pigeon Forge is your one stop for affordable family fun! Kids can ride bumper cars, jump on a bungy trampoline, travel through a mirror maze, complete a ropes course and more! There is even an arcade where they can win awesome prizes and kid-friendly roller coasters to try. Before you leave, make sure to ride The Great Smoky Mountain Wheel, which provides a breathtaking view of the Smoky Mountains from a glass gondola that fits the whole family.
